Alexis Sanchez has told the media in Chile that he has grown as a player since signing for Arsenal.

The frontman took the Premier League by storm in his first season and his magnificent strike in the FA Cup final was simply the massive, shiny cherry on top of his pie of awesomeness.

“I had a breakthrough in my football life,” Sanchez said at the press conference ahead of the start of the Copa America on 11th June. “Now I switch to the left, I make goals, I pass, I am evolving.

“And if I’m put in at centre forward, I will do it in the best way possible and I am fit to play.”

Grabbing 25 goals and 12 assists, Sanchez also led Arsenal in the Hleb pass (assisting the assister) with 10 of those as well.
